NDRF to get two additional battalions

In order to strengthen the National Disaster Response Force (NDRF), two battalions of the Sashastra Seema Bal (SSB) will be converted into those of the NDRF.

The union cabinet, presided over by Prime Minister Narendra Modi, approved the proposal here on Wednesday, an official statement said.

The conversion is meant to provide quicker response to eastern Uttar Pradesh, Madhya Pradesh and Arunachal Pradesh during any natural or man-made disaster and enhance the capability of the existing NDRF battalions.

The two new NDRF battalions will be deployed at Varanasi and Arunachal Pradesh, the communique added.
